Folk Hero - a solo mode and sourcebook for the Punk is Dead TTRPG

Created by Critical Kit Ltd

Folk Hero is the first official expansion for The Punk is Dead songwriting TTRPG. In addition to new roles, lore and gigs to play, the 90 page, 7 inch hardback contains a new solo mode.

So, here are our thoughts for our future Crowdfunding strategy and we would love your feedback:

  • To do a maximum of two large campaigns a year and never launch a large campaign without having fulfilled the previous one.
  • To launch a new Zine of The Month campaign that will have precreated, quick turnaround projects (as we did on Unleashed).

Let's look at Zine of the Month in more details:

  • Each month we will crowdfund a new TTRPG zine with a price range of £5-£20.
  • Campaigns will last 21 days (1st to 21st of the month).
  • Campaigns will be fulfilled the following month.
  • We will use a network of distributors in the UK, US and EU to keep shipping costs low and in many cases we will subsidise shipping.
  • As well as my own work, we will publish new creators from across the world that I have curated for their originality.
  • There will be no stretch goals.
  • There will be a consistent early bird of a free signed art postcard of the game cover.
  • There will be all of our other games available on each campaign with a one-size-fits-all shipping rate.
  • We will not sell these games publicly until the month following fulfilment, so backers get the first copies before they are in retail.
